Job Description:
Summary:Information Technology Architect II is a technical
planning resource within the organization, and fulfills a
coordination and leadership role in the development of technical
strategies and solutions as related to Database, Data Model & ETL
(Extract, Transform & Load). Also has extensive technical knowledge
and experience in multiple core technology areas and integration,
along with strong planning and analytical skills. The Data
Warehouse Architect is responsible for data warehouse architecture
and design and development of data model & ETL requiring multiple
technologies. Also works as part of cross-functional teams that
deal with the full spectrum of information management technology.
Individual must have a good working knowledge of different types of
philosophies when it comes to design and development of data
warehouse architecture, design and development of complex ETL and
design and development of logical & physical data model using
Kimball methodology of start schema. The Data Warehouse Architect
must have proven competency in the following areas: working with
large multi terabytes of data warehouse, performance tuning of
database & SQL queries, designing & developing complex ETL
packages. Works with various technical resources across the team to
facilitate the development of technical standards. Must have the
communication skills and ability to develop and present solutions
to all levels of management, including executive levels. The Data
Warehouse Architect participates in requirements gathering,
discovery, and interfacing with technical and business teams -
establishing credibility in terms of experience, presentation and
leadership of solutions development. The Data Warehouse Architect
evaluates proposed new systems and system changes and additions,
provides oversight into the decision process, and participates in
project implementation.
